Among the secrets that remained till the end of the show, Claudia got away with setting up her son Steve, which directly got him killed.
Joan Van Ark and Donna Mills return to the series for the finale.
Mack burns the tape in the fireplace, to hide the evidence from the police. Just 1 season earlier, Karen had (partially) burned Meg's birth certificate in the fireplace, to hide the evidence from Brian Johnston.
Bill Nolan compares Paige's degree on the wall with not knowing everything about business.This matches that in earlier seasons they said Paige had an arts degree, not business.
Greg visits Laura's tombstone in this episode, which reads: "Laura Sumner 1948-1987".
Karen receives a telephone call from her son Michael in this episode, although the phone call is one sided Michael is neither seen nor heard.
Val calls Gary by his full name, Garrison Arthur Ewing.
Steve Brewer is confirmed dead, marking him the 2nd half brother of Greg's to be killed. (Although the 1st, Peter Hollister, had faked his relation to Greg.)
Among the names on the Sumner Group's employee phone list is Lois Ewing, sharing the same last name (though unlikely related) as Gary.
In this episode, Kate dyes her hair black to prevent her losing streak at tennis. In reality, Stacy Galina (Kate) wore a red wig as Kate and stopped wearing the wig beginning with this episode.
This marks the 2nd time the house to the right of Frank (previously Laura) has been sold as devalued.The 1st time when Abby rented it, it was devalued due to Sid being accused of rape. This time it was because Danny drowned in the pool.
Meg's nanny, Barbara, states her last name is Kinney when introducing herself to Claudia.
Greg calls Mort, "Mortsky" for the first time. He would continue to do so for the rest of the show.
Although the previous episode hinted it, this episode confirms that Danny drowned in the pool at Abby's old house.
Although the character of Greg had been on "Knots Landing" for years, he never once mentioned he had a sister, not even when his mother Ruth came to town or when it was revealed that he had a half-brother (Peter). In fact, when Ruth was in town, she told Abby that she wished Abby was the daughter that she never had. What about Claudia?
The Knots Landing theme song is played in a church organ style.
In this episode, we find out the real reason why Linda is staying with the Mackenzie's: she and Eric are separated.
This is a rare episode where Karen has very few lines.
Eric and Linda are mentioned, but do not appear in this episode.
The flashback of Gary's first conversation with Sally's friend shows her with brunette hair. This is an alternate footage, as Sally's friend had blonde hair when they first spoke.
